The main objective of this research proposal is to explore the electrical properties of nanoscale devices and circuits based on nanolayers.
Nanolayers cover a wide span of possible electronic properties, ranging from semiconducting to superconducting.
The possibility to form electrical circuits by varying their geometry offers rich research and practical opportunities.
